How a Sports GOAT Voting Platform Actually Works

Understanding the mechanics behind a sports GOAT voting platform is key to appreciating why this format resonates so strongly with fans. Not all platforms are built the same way, but the best ones share a few critical design principles: clarity, fairness, and community ownership.

On GoatWars, the experience is structured around head-to-head battles. Here's how the process unfolds step by step:

  1. Choose a league or category: Start by selecting the debate arena — quarterbacks, basketball players, tennis legends, rappers, candy bars, and more. The multi-category approach means you're not limited to just one sport.
  2. Enter the head-to-head matchup: Two contenders are presented side by side. You pick the one you believe is the greater of the two based on your own knowledge, passion, and criteria.
  3. Build your personal GOAT List: As you vote, a personalized ranked list begins to take shape, reflecting your specific preferences and matchup outcomes.
  4. Compare with the global community: Your list is placed alongside the live global GOAT List, letting you see how your rankings align with — or diverge from — the broader fan consensus.
  5. Share and debate: Personal lists are shareable, turning your rankings into conversation starters on social media, in group chats, and among friends.

This format is powerful because it forces specificity. It's easy to say "Jordan is the GOAT." It's harder — and more illuminating — to choose between Jordan and Magic Johnson, then between Jordan and Kobe Bryant, then between Kobe and LeBron. Each individual decision reveals something about what you actually value in greatness. That's what makes the head-to-head format so addictive and so much more meaningful than a simple poll.

The Psychology Behind GOAT Debates: Why We Love Them

Sports GOAT debates are ancient by internet standards. Long before a sports GOAT voting platform made the process formal, fans were arguing these questions in locker rooms, sports bars, and newspaper letters sections. What is it about the GOAT question that makes it so enduringly compelling?

Research in sports psychology suggests that GOAT debates tap into a cluster of deeply satisfying cognitive and social needs. First, they activate tribal identity — your GOAT is often an extension of your team allegiance, regional pride, or generational loyalty. Defending your GOAT is, in a sense, defending a part of yourself.

Second, GOAT debates are appealing because they are genuinely unanswerable in any final, definitive sense. There is no objective formula for greatness that everyone agrees on. This ambiguity isn't a flaw in the debate — it's the feature. If there were a clear, inarguable answer, the conversation would die immediately. The fact that reasonable, intelligent fans can arrive at completely different conclusions is exactly what keeps the debate alive across generations.

Third, participatory engagement — the ability to actually influence an outcome — dramatically increases investment and enjoyment. Studies in behavioral economics consistently show that people value outcomes they helped create more highly than outcomes they simply observed. A sports GOAT voting platform converts passive fandom into active participation, which is why the format drives so much stronger engagement than a traditional poll or article.

Myth: GOAT rankings on fan voting platforms are just popularity contests that favor the most famous athletes, not the greatest ones.
Reality: Head-to-head matchup formats naturally control for raw popularity by forcing direct comparisons rather than open-ended votes. When a fan must choose between two specific athletes side-by-side, they are prompted to evaluate relative greatness rather than simply naming a recognizable star. Over thousands of votes, this process produces nuanced, position-by-position rankings that often differ significantly from simple name-recognition polls.
